Skip to content
This repository has been archived by the owner on Nov 27, 2024. It is now read-only.

Commit

Permalink
Merge pull request #502 from imincik/weekly-update-2024.27
Browse files Browse the repository at this point in the history
pkgs: weekly update (weekly-update-2024.27)
  • Loading branch information
imincik authored Jul 4, 2024
2 parents 47cd8ff + a8bffca commit 3a77b4b
Show file tree
Hide file tree
Showing 7 changed files with 50 additions and 47 deletions.
6 changes: 3 additions & 3 deletions flake.lock

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

13 changes: 2 additions & 11 deletions pkgs/gdal/default.nix
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,6 @@
, stdenv
, callPackage
, fetchFromGitHub
, fetchpatch

, useMinimalFeatures ? false
, useTiledb ? (!useMinimalFeatures) && !(stdenv.isDarwin && stdenv.isx86_64)
Expand Down Expand Up @@ -80,23 +79,15 @@

stdenv.mkDerivation (finalAttrs: {
pname = "gdal" + lib.optionalString useMinimalFeatures "-minimal";
version = "3.9.0";
version = "3.9.1";

src = fetchFromGitHub {
owner = "OSGeo";
repo = "gdal";
rev = "v${finalAttrs.version}";
hash = "sha256-xEekgF9GzsPYkwk7Nny9b1DMLTxBqTSdudYxaz4jl/c=";
hash = "sha256-WCTQHUU2WYYiliwCJ4PsbvJIOar9LmvXn/i5jJzTCtM=";
};

patches = [
# HDF5: add support for libhdf5 >= 1.14.4.2 when built with Float16
(fetchpatch {
url = "https://github.com/OSGeo/gdal/commit/16ade8253f26200246abb5ab24d17e18216e7a11.patch";
sha256 = "sha256-N6YqfcOUWeaJXVE9RUo1dzulxqIY5Q/UygPnZHau3Lc=";
})
];

nativeBuildInputs = [
bison
cmake
Expand Down
4 changes: 2 additions & 2 deletions pkgs/gdal/master-rev.nix
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
{
rev = "d6a7db5";
hash = "sha256-ZUhYNpQSSTv0nDHRdWCjtQTxmCZsr74QUcqgtz/I/kc=";
rev = "c89aeb4";
hash = "sha256-aiYwZaXonn8FHz8jYDCSl+tLSnoQO1Xkdrx84HcgdxY=";
}
31 changes: 19 additions & 12 deletions pkgs/qgis/qgis-ltr-plugins-list.nix
Original file line number Diff line number Diff line change
Expand Up @@ -64,9 +64,9 @@


Lizmap = {
version = "4.3.17";
url = "https://plugins.qgis.org/plugins/lizmap/version/4.3.17/download/";
hash = "sha256-slw8raRUsr+MaO37vgJamB9vN4Bmlo46CMwesO4TlvM=";
version = "4.3.19";
url = "https://plugins.qgis.org/plugins/lizmap/version/4.3.19/download/";
hash = "sha256-qbSlsGyDnDw1becVPIchDNAS2w1Sk2KnoZAM0xbRpUA=";
};


Expand Down Expand Up @@ -155,9 +155,9 @@


PDOK-services-plugin = {
version = "5.0.1";
url = "https://plugins.qgis.org/plugins/pdokservicesplugin/version/5.0.1/download/";
hash = "sha256-vAdRuDASeEIUju2JNDO4srLk7Eq1wp70CQ5hd4yomuI=";
version = "5.1.0";
url = "https://plugins.qgis.org/plugins/pdokservicesplugin/version/5.1.0/download/";
hash = "sha256-TgpNgGSOLKmsP+It0xLkZqFCrBD8/aZrMbyRj9ZD/0w=";
};


Expand Down Expand Up @@ -225,9 +225,9 @@


cadastre = {
version = "1.19.1";
url = "https://plugins.qgis.org/plugins/cadastre/version/1.19.1/download/";
hash = "sha256-JfmRXMqIcyezppFNGdRcUYjC0hvdJm9wOqF2GPPNkrI=";
version = "1.19.2";
url = "https://plugins.qgis.org/plugins/cadastre/version/1.19.2/download/";
hash = "sha256-RaG5Bl5hePmjUVc6RgZFE5TfVH//PCA80TJ25N1lpNg=";
};


Expand Down Expand Up @@ -483,6 +483,13 @@
};


Plugin-Builder-3 = {
version = "3.2.1";
url = "https://plugins.qgis.org/plugins/pluginbuilder3/version/3.2.1/download/";
hash = "sha256-60ZjJtc5aTgsTh3uJ5Qb1Eg1izNlkn4TB7TA7o3l+uU=";
};


Shape-Tools = {
version = "3.4.19";
url = "https://plugins.qgis.org/plugins/shapetools/version/3.4.19/download/";
Expand Down Expand Up @@ -638,9 +645,9 @@


Pobieracz-danych-GUGiK = {
version = "1.2.0";
url = "https://plugins.qgis.org/plugins/pobieracz_danych_gugik/version/1.2.0/download/";
hash = "sha256-cs6sidg3ND+vENo3o0jBjPUO9iTMmrwr71ySKkzdeVs=";
version = "1.2.1";
url = "https://plugins.qgis.org/plugins/pobieracz_danych_gugik/version/1.2.1/download/";
hash = "sha256-F4FSRmQbf13zxyu+VC2kcl6GsXQA5KXNpQPapZqKkGE=";
};


Expand Down
31 changes: 19 additions & 12 deletions pkgs/qgis/qgis-plugins-list.nix
Original file line number Diff line number Diff line change
Expand Up @@ -64,9 +64,9 @@


Lizmap = {
version = "4.3.17";
url = "https://plugins.qgis.org/plugins/lizmap/version/4.3.17/download/";
hash = "sha256-slw8raRUsr+MaO37vgJamB9vN4Bmlo46CMwesO4TlvM=";
version = "4.3.19";
url = "https://plugins.qgis.org/plugins/lizmap/version/4.3.19/download/";
hash = "sha256-qbSlsGyDnDw1becVPIchDNAS2w1Sk2KnoZAM0xbRpUA=";
};


Expand Down Expand Up @@ -155,9 +155,9 @@


PDOK-services-plugin = {
version = "5.0.1";
url = "https://plugins.qgis.org/plugins/pdokservicesplugin/version/5.0.1/download/";
hash = "sha256-vAdRuDASeEIUju2JNDO4srLk7Eq1wp70CQ5hd4yomuI=";
version = "5.1.0";
url = "https://plugins.qgis.org/plugins/pdokservicesplugin/version/5.1.0/download/";
hash = "sha256-TgpNgGSOLKmsP+It0xLkZqFCrBD8/aZrMbyRj9ZD/0w=";
};


Expand Down Expand Up @@ -225,9 +225,9 @@


cadastre = {
version = "1.19.1";
url = "https://plugins.qgis.org/plugins/cadastre/version/1.19.1/download/";
hash = "sha256-JfmRXMqIcyezppFNGdRcUYjC0hvdJm9wOqF2GPPNkrI=";
version = "1.19.2";
url = "https://plugins.qgis.org/plugins/cadastre/version/1.19.2/download/";
hash = "sha256-RaG5Bl5hePmjUVc6RgZFE5TfVH//PCA80TJ25N1lpNg=";
};


Expand Down Expand Up @@ -483,6 +483,13 @@
};


Plugin-Builder-3 = {
version = "3.2.1";
url = "https://plugins.qgis.org/plugins/pluginbuilder3/version/3.2.1/download/";
hash = "sha256-60ZjJtc5aTgsTh3uJ5Qb1Eg1izNlkn4TB7TA7o3l+uU=";
};


Shape-Tools = {
version = "3.4.19";
url = "https://plugins.qgis.org/plugins/shapetools/version/3.4.19/download/";
Expand Down Expand Up @@ -638,9 +645,9 @@


Pobieracz-danych-GUGiK = {
version = "1.2.0";
url = "https://plugins.qgis.org/plugins/pobieracz_danych_gugik/version/1.2.0/download/";
hash = "sha256-cs6sidg3ND+vENo3o0jBjPUO9iTMmrwr71ySKkzdeVs=";
version = "1.2.1";
url = "https://plugins.qgis.org/plugins/pobieracz_danych_gugik/version/1.2.1/download/";
hash = "sha256-F4FSRmQbf13zxyu+VC2kcl6GsXQA5KXNpQPapZqKkGE=";
};


Expand Down
10 changes: 4 additions & 6 deletions pkgs/qgis/unwrapped-ltr.nix
Original file line number Diff line number Diff line change
Expand Up @@ -73,14 +73,14 @@ let
urllib3
];
in mkDerivation rec {
version = "3.34.7";
version = "3.34.8";
pname = "qgis-ltr-unwrapped";

src = fetchFromGitHub {
owner = "qgis";
repo = "QGIS";
rev = "final-${lib.replaceStrings [ "." ] [ "_" ] version}";
hash = "sha256-6fIBmIoCVo0AtkjC4Vn3jMjz93gZmvkFAgo+KnasyXo=";
hash = "sha256-UeyGx+C7szXv++hXFV006Xk4oSKfSj4teJIwaD4ODVk=";
};

passthru = {
Expand Down Expand Up @@ -143,9 +143,7 @@ in mkDerivation rec {

# Add path to Qt platform plugins
# (offscreen is needed by "${APIS_SRC_DIR}/generate_console_pap.py")
preBuild = ''
export QT_QPA_PLATFORM_PLUGIN_PATH=${qtbase.bin}/lib/qt-${qtbase.version}/plugins/platforms
'';
env.QT_QPA_PLATFORM_PLUGIN_PATH="${qtbase}/${qtbase.qtPluginPrefix}/platforms";

cmakeFlags = [
"-DCMAKE_BUILD_TYPE=Release"
Expand All @@ -160,7 +158,7 @@ in mkDerivation rec {
);

qtWrapperArgs = [
"--set QT_QPA_PLATFORM_PLUGIN_PATH ${qtbase.bin}/lib/qt-${qtbase.version}/plugins/platforms"
"--set QT_QPA_PLATFORM_PLUGIN_PATH ${qtbase}/${qtbase.qtPluginPrefix}/platforms"
];

dontWrapGApps = true; # wrapper params passed below
Expand Down
2 changes: 1 addition & 1 deletion tests/custom-package/flake.nix
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@
};

inputs = {
geonix.url = "github:imincik/geospatial-nix";
geonix.url = "path:../../.";
nixpkgs.follows = "geonix/nixpkgs";
};

Expand Down

0 comments on commit 3a77b4b

Please sign in to comment.